As nouns the difference between disinfectant and proflavine

is that disinfectant is a substance which kills germs and/or viruses while proflavine is (organic compound) a disinfectant, acridine-3,6-diamine , bacteriostatic against many gram-positive bacteria.

As an adjective disinfectant

is referring to something that contains a disinfectant or has the properties of a disinfectant.
